It’s always worth paying money to see Andrew W.K. Tonight, his solo piano performance is doubly worth your cash because the proceeds are going to fight cancer. His show tonight at Santos Party House is a benefit for the Leukemia and Lymphoma Society, a group that funds blood cancer research. Also playing is Mon Khmer, Roadside Graves and Deradorian. Cancer is one of those diseases who has affected everyone at some point, so come to this show and tell cancer to suck it. (Also, there’s free Colt 45 from 7 to 8pm).

For The Mustache That You Love, Leukemia and Lymphoma Society Benefit
Santos Party House
96 Lafayette Street, between White and Walker Streets [Manhattan]
Monday, May 3, 7pm
$12 at the door
